Started as POW! WOW! Hawai’i 11 years ago in Kakaʻako, the renamed street art event Hawai’i Walls 2023 has invited more than 80 local and visiting artists to paint 70 new wall murals in the neighborhoods of Kapālama Kai, Kalihi, and Pālama. Hawai’i Walls invites the community to discover the creative process of public art in locations (see building addresses below) from Monday, May 8 through Sunday, May 14. Hawai’i Walls 2023 street art locations
- Dillingham Plaza, 1505 Dillingham Blvd, Honolulu, HI 96817
- Waiakamilo Industrial Complex, 1451 Kalani St, Honolulu, HI 96817
- Kaumualii Warehouse, 1299 Kaumualii St, Honolulu, HI 96817
- Building at 641 Waiakamilo Rd, Honolulu, HI 96817
